The Shoestring Technical Manual addresses in some detail the fact that most versions will have both a full and a partial download. Basically, a full download has everything you need if you are installing Shoestring from scratch. A partial download has just what's changed since the last release, for people who already have the last release. Major releases, in which almost everything may have changed, may have only a full download. See the manual for more details.
The software is released in a Windows .ZIP compressed file, but all files within contain *nix line feeds. This somewhat schizophrenic arrangement is mainly due to my own working environment: I develop locally on a Windows machine, hence the .ZIP compression, but use an ISP that runs on Linux, so I convert all the line feeds to that style when releasing. I've found, however, that DOS/Windows line feeds don't cause too much problem on *nix systems, and probably most of my audience is browsing in Windows or, if not, have a tool that can uncompress .ZIP files, so I hope this works for you. If it does not, contact me and I'll work with you.
